切换到宽版
  • 广告投放
  • 稿件投递
  • 繁體中文
    • 938阅读
    • 0回复

    [分享]VirtualLab Fusion 中的参数耦合 [复制链接]

    上一主题 下一主题
    离线infotek
     
    发帖
    5937
    光币
    23838
    光券
    0
    只看楼主 倒序阅读 楼主  发表于: 2021-06-01
    摘要 UQ~rVUo.c  
    t}gqk'  
    VirtualLab 中的参数耦合功能能够耦合任意光学系统中的每一个参数。不仅如此,这些值可用来重新计算其他参数,因此这个功能也可以创建这些参数之间复杂的关系。例如,如果光学系统的特定参数在变化或优化期间具有固定关系,则参数耦合功能就十分有用。 'a*IZb-M  
    !Esiq<Yh  
    !:e qPpz  
    6vA 5;a@  
    系统参数耦合 ,;18:  
    jwox?]f+  
    xw H`alu  
     为使用VirtualLab中的参数耦合功能,可通过对于一个光学系统激活”Use Parameter Coupling”。 20)Il:x  
     然后,“Edit Parameter Coupling”按钮变为可用。 !W7ekPnK  
     通过点击“Edit Parameter Coupling”按钮,出现参数耦合向导。 2[hl^f^%,  
    i=+6R  
    2ZeL  
    8msDJ {,X  
    选择相关的参数 Nb1lawC  
    Akf9nT  
     通过点击“Next”,出现如下所示标签,其中包含了当前光学系统的所有参数。 E>D@#I>  
     请选择所有的耦合参数和必要的计算。例如,选择光栅界面的参数“ZExtension”和“Distance”。 0]~n8mB>  
    `-\ "p;Hp0  
    s#[Ej&2[=  
    zL'n J  
    源代码编辑器 "kC>EtaX  
     在选择参数之后,必须设置控制耦合的代码片段。 |9 3%,  
     通过点击“Edit”,打开源代码编辑器。 iz(+(M  
    =qvU9p2o  
    5KSsRq/8"  
    Gov{jksr  
    源代码编辑 wSMgBRV#^  
     源代码选项卡包含三个区域: enj2xye%Y  
    −源代码(区域中心)(1) d6VKUAk'7>  
    −全局变量参数(右上角)(2) Dr:}k*  
    −选择系统参数(右下)(3) ijB,Q>TgO  
    OUPpz_y  
    CmZ?uo+Y  
    ^l,Jbt  
    参数耦合的一般实例 DI7trR`  
     通常,选择的参数必须从代码库中读取并保存到变量(第4行)。 ceCshxTU  
     然后,该值可以作为另一个参数的输出,并进一步计算,例如double(第7行)。 $7,dKC &  
    b4wJnmC8  
    oSoG&4  
    TxWj gW~  
    定义全局坐标系 n'H\*9t  
     在这个特定的例子中,定义一个新的全局变量是很有帮助的,它稍后会出现在参数耦合窗口中。 I"1\R8 R  
     这可以在“Global Parameters”选项卡中完成。 s7?kU3 y=s  
     变量可以显示不同的类型和物理量。 S}E@*t2 h  
    :EjIV]e  
    参数耦合的特殊实例 hbK+\X  
     在本例中,使用全局变量将其值返回给系统的两个选定参数。 THJ+OnP  
     因此,不需要从字典中读取或重新计算参数。 ln.~>FO  
    5a/)|  
    }!LYV  
     关闭源代码编辑器后,将出现已定义的全局变量“GratingHeight”。 U#}.r<  
    (ni$wjq=z^  
    v\c3=DbO  
    gyK"#-/_d  
    最后检查系统的参数耦合 Q7\Ax0  
    WA/\x  
     在向导的最后一页,可以检查返回的参数和值。 &,/T<V  
    , ]MX&]  
    c2nZd.SD|  
    i@RjG   
    文件和技术信息 4$^=1ax  
    L0Cf@~k  
    kLhtkuS4  
    U uys G\  
    rW^&8E[  
    QQ:2987619807 SXL6)pX  
     
    分享到